1. Size Matters: Understanding the Lion Dog’s Stature
Pekingese, or Lion Dogs, are a small breed with a lot of attitude. Typically, they weigh between 7 to 14 pounds (3 to 6 kg), standing about 6 to 9 inches (15 to 23 cm) tall at the shoulder. Despite their diminutive size, these dogs pack a punch when it comes to personality. Think of them as the pint-sized emperors of your household. 😸👑
While there are variations within the breed, it’s rare to find a Pekingese that exceeds these standard measurements. However, their size doesn’t diminish their impact. These dogs were originally bred to be companions for Chinese royalty, and their stature has remained relatively consistent over the centuries. 2. What Makes the Lion Dog Unique?
The Pekingese isn’t just about its size; it’s all about the attitude. Their signature lion-like mane, flat faces, and stocky build make them instantly recognizable. They’re not just cute; they’re a work of canine art. But don’t be fooled by their plush exterior; these dogs are tough and independent, traits that make them a joy to own. 🦁💪
One of the most distinctive features of the Pekingese is their long, flowing coats. These can come in a variety of colors, from black and white to red and sable, each one more stunning than the last. Their coats require regular grooming to keep them looking their best, but the effort is worth it for those Instagram-worthy moments. 📸🐾
3. Living with a Lion Dog: Tips and Tricks
Living with a Pekingese means embracing a lifestyle filled with charm and character. While they’re small, they’re not lapdogs in the traditional sense. They love to be active and involved in family life, making them great companions for those who enjoy a balance of cuddling and playtime. 🏃♀️🐾
One thing to note is that Pekingese can be stubborn, which means training requires patience and consistency. Positive reinforcement works wonders with this breed, and early socialization can help them become well-rounded pets. Additionally, due to their flat faces, they can struggle with hot weather and exercise, so it’s important to keep them cool and avoid overexertion. 🌞💦
